EICRs and landlord compliance in Maidstone

Landlord compliance is the core of what we do in Maidstone. The 2020 PRS regulations require a satisfactory EICR every five years and before each new tenancy, with the certificate supplied to tenants and to Maidstone Borough Council on request. Penalties for going without run to £30,000. Frequently asked questions

My fuse board looks old, does it need replacing?

Not always, but an older rewireable or split-load board with no RCD protection is a common reason a property doesn't pass an EICR. A modern consumer unit puts RCD protection on every circuit and brings the installation up to current standards. We'll tell you honestly whether yours genuinely needs changing or whether it's still safe to leave, no pressure to replace something that doesn't need it.
